I have a show on the last day of the month. How long do I have to close out that show, so that the hostess receives the May special and her guests get the HWC products? And If I close it out on June 3rd (for example) that will count towards my June totals, not May, correct?

Thanks,

Dawn
 
I believe you have 30 days from the date of a show to submit it. I've never waited that long, so I'm not entirely sure. As long as your May show is dated in May, you can submit it June 3rd.

And, I assume that it would then count toward the sales we need to have to earn the free fall products, right? :D
 
ExactlyWhen you submit your show, the show total goes towards the month that it was submitted. Just think, you'll be that much closer to the FREE fall products!! :D
 
Special Bonus RequirementsBut, if you want to earn the Special Bonus: "Hold and Submit your 2 shows June 1-15 and you'll also receive a special product with an approximate value of $20."
 
MSmith said:
But, if you want to earn the Special Bonus: "Hold and Submit your 2 shows June 1-15 and you'll also receive a special product with an approximate value of $20."
Right....to get the bonus, though, any May shows won't count toward this since shows have to be held during those June dates. But, overall sales (even from May shows) would be counted in the monthly sales.

What does it mean to close out a show?

Closing out a show refers to the process of finalizing all orders and transactions after a Pampered Chef party or event. This includes collecting payments, submitting orders, and ensuring that all host rewards and guest orders are accurately processed.

How do I submit orders after a show?

To submit orders after a show, you will need to log into your Pampered Chef consultant account, navigate to the 'Shows' section, and select the show you wish to close. From there, you can enter the orders, apply any host rewards, and finalize the submission. Make sure to double-check all details before submitting.

What are host rewards, and how do they work?

Host rewards are incentives given to hosts based on the sales generated during their show. These rewards can include discounts, free products, and exclusive items. The amount of rewards a host receives is typically determined by the total sales amount, with specific thresholds set by Pampered Chef.

When should I close out a show?

It is recommended to close out a show within a few days after the event to ensure timely processing of orders and delivery. This also helps to maintain good communication with your host and guests, ensuring they receive their products as soon as possible.

What if I have issues with closing out a show?

If you encounter issues while closing out a show, you can reach out to Pampered Chef's consultant support for assistance. They can help troubleshoot any problems you may face, whether it's technical difficulties or questions about order processing and host rewards.
